Introduction

Prophet has a wide variety of potential item builds due to him being relevant at almost all points of the game. He is a terrific split pusher, pusher, 1v1 laner(including mid in some matchups)and can farm well.

Advantages of prophet are:

    Can lane almost anywhere
    Can farm faster than most carries
    Able to contribute globally
    Can farm more efficiently than other carries and farm where it would be too risky for carries

Disadvantages of Prophet are:
    Squishy
    His Sprouts aren't very good against experienced players

Offlane Natures Prophet (Position 3)

Offlane prophet is where prophet is mostly played in this meta at higher skill tiers as his treants provide great harass to enemies as well as mess with creep equilibrium to make sure the lane comes towers your tower where you can farm safely.

Offlane prophet in 1v1 offlane is extremely strong at not only harassing the enemy but being able to help your carry and mid if they get ganked as well as being able to help securing first blood

A common mistake I see people making with Natures prophet is that they neglect to get sheep/orchid/necro and go for maelstrom. The problem with this is that it leaves your hero with ok pushing potential while being pretty weak in ganks in comparison to the other 3 item choices. Sheep also makes you tankier and allows you to survive ganks you may of otherwise died from such as against a clockwerk.

Mid Natures Prophet

Mid natures prophet build is extremely situational and as such you should build accordingly, although most item builds will work.

Jungle Natures (Position 4)

Jungle Prophet is a precarious role in some circumstances as his jungling is easy to shut down. When you pick jungle natures you have to trust that your carry can handle the opposing lane with just the position 5 support to help him. Jungle natures is only done in greedier lineups because natures prophet isnt incredibly useful in a 3v3.

Benefits of prophet jungle is that you will have a very rich position 4 support as prophet tends to farm more efficiently than most other heroes.

Natures Prophet can also rush for a quick medallion to allow your team to take an early rosh.

Hard Carry Prophet (Position 1)

This style of prophet is fairly risky without a coordinated team as hard carry prophet is generally only used with a pushing/ganking lineup. Prophet hard carry main weakness is that he can't let the game go late as he gets outcarry by most other carries.
